How AI Weighs Information Sources to Recommend B2B Suppliers
When AI tools recommend B2B suppliers, they rarely rely on a single webpage. Instead, they assign “source weights” by synthesizing multiple signals: authority (official websites and trusted publications), relevance to the buyer’s intent, cross-source consistency, verifiability through case studies/certifications/data, and freshness of updates. This multi-signal evaluation helps reduce risk in procurement decisions by building an evidence chain that can be validated across independent sources. In practice, supplier visibility improves when brand claims on the website align with third-party listings, industry media coverage, structured FAQs, technical documentation, and continuously updated proof points. A new paradigm of integrated marketing: How can SEO capture search traffic and GEO capture AI traffic, working together?
The traffic entry point for B2B foreign trade enterprises is shifting from "search clicks" to "AI providing direct answers." SEO solves the problem of discoverability ("being found in searches"), while GEO (Generative Engine Optimization) solves the problem of citationability ("being recommended and cited by AI") and trust building. To achieve dual-engine growth, the key lies in unifying semantics and content structure: using H1-H3 and keywords to support SEO ranking, and using question-oriented expressions, citationable conclusion paragraphs, and structured information to adapt to AI retrieval and citation; simultaneously establishing a content chain of "SEO entry layer—GEO explanation layer—conversion connection layer," and monitoring ranking clicks and AI citation recommendation frequency in conjunction, continuously reusing and upgrading existing SEO assets into semantic assets that AI can call upon. Does social media influence GEO? Analyzing the AI engine's logic for capturing social media buzz.
Social signals do indeed influence AI recommendations in GEO (Generative Engine Optimization), but the key lies not in likes and follower counts, but in cross-platform "semantic consistency." AI engines capture mentions, comments, and discussions from social media, industry forums, and Q&A platforms. Through semantic aggregation, consistency judgment, and anomaly detection, they assess brand authenticity, product discussion volume, and reputation trends, ultimately deciding whether to cite and recommend these messages. How does GEO avoid controversies surrounding "information monopoly" and "answer bias"? (Case Study)
With the widespread adoption of AI search and generative answers, GEO (Generative Engine Optimization) is prone to controversies surrounding "information monopoly" and "answer bias." When content is overly concentrated on a single brand/domain, strongly marketed, and lacks neutral comparative information, AI may identify it as single-source bias, leading to unstable recommendations or even demotion.
